We were searching for smørrebrød(traditional Danish open faced sandwiches) in Copenhagen while visiting over Christmas, and this was one of the only options that was open. However, it turned out to be a great last resort! The neighborhood was super nice to stroll through and the place itself was located on a cozy street corner. The interior of the place was even quainter than the outside. It was small enough to feel intimate without feeling cramped. As far as food goes, the smørrebrød was great, though it was slightly surprising that I had to assemble the sandwich myself once the plate arrived. I got the Sailor’s Plate, which was a special that included 4 types of smørrebrød. It was very reasonably priced for the amount of food it included. My husband got the wiener schnitzel and loved it as well. We all tried some of the house schnapps for fun, and there were tons of flavors to choose from. Unfortunately schnapps isn’t my favorite drink, so I can’t give am objective review on that experience… The only possible downside was that our waitress was a little snappy with us at times. Perhaps it was a cultural barrier though, because she was also very informative and helpful at other times throughout the meal. I would definitely go back!

Loved this place. Had the roast beef smorrebrod, which was actually VEAL. Pretty cheap at only 90 kroner, which, at the time of review, is like 12USD. I stumbled in here after being caught in a terrific rainstorm, and the kitchen was closed. The chef was nice enough to whip up a plate for me, and the waitress was extremely kind. As an American unfamiliar with Nordic/Danish cuisine, I had a lot of questions and the waitress was patient and helpful. Of course, like most Danes under 70, she spoke perfect English. Free wifi and a cozy(hygge) atmosphere was the perfect way to ride out the storm.

You’ll enjoy the views at this often packed Danish restaurant with a very quaint, charming interior. They serve up a good variety of smørrebrød piled high with meats and fish, all heavy with a variety of sauces coupled with a good variety of Danish beers. Service was very friendly and helpful even though it was quite slow because it was busy but we had a great server. Prices will be a bit high but it’s Copenhagen so don’t be shocked. This is a nice place for lunch.
